The Unforgettable Experience of Traditional Jhal Muri

My foray into the world of Jhal Muri was a thrilling experience that sent my senses into overdrive. This Bengali street food marvel is a delightful mix of puffed rice, roasted peanuts, and a medley of spices. What truly sets it apart is the inclusion of tangy mustard oil and fresh herbs, creating a dance of flavours that is simply unforgettable. I can still hear the sizzles and pops from the vendor’s cart as I eagerly devoured this crunchy delight, all while trying to remember not to make a mess!

Navigating the Hawker Centres: Where to Find Vegan Options

Navigating hawker centres is a bit like initiating a treasure hunt, especially for vegans. When I visit, I often look for stalls that have “vegetarian” emblazoned proudly on their signage. Some of them serve dishes like char kway teow or nasi lemak made vegan-friendly, and you’ll find locals eagerly lining up to grab a plate. Just ask around, and you might find fellow diners willing to share their favourite vegan picks!

The Must-Try Vegan Dishes You Didn’t Know Existed

When exploring the Singapore vegan scene, you’ll stumble upon some surprisingly delightful creations that might just change your life — or at least your lunch! For example, Singapore’s famed laksa often has a vegan rendition that swaps fish for tofu, making it just as comforting without the guilt. I also discovered jackfruit curry, which makes for a fantastic meat alternative. Trust me; these dishes are not just for your vegan friends; they’re for anyone who enjoys tasty fare!

In Singapore, the vegan culinary scene is bursting with creativity and flavour, with dishes that will surprise even the most dedicated carnivores. One of my personal favourites is the monkey head mushroom satay crafted by a hawker in Chinatown — it’s marinated just right and grilled to perfection. Pair that with a vibrant peanut sauce, and you’re in for a treat! Don’t skip out on trying some of the local favourites like roti john with a hearty veggie filling, which will have you giggling in delight after each bite.
